A 3D POMOF based on a {AsW<sub>12</sub>} cluster and a Ag-MOF with interpenetrating channels for large-capacity aqueous asymmetric supercapacitors and highly selective biosensors for the detection of hydrogen peroxide

Liping Cui, Kai Yu, Jinghua Lv, Changhong Guo, Baibin Zhou

2020Journal of Materials Chemistry A116 citationsDOI

Abstract

{AsW<sub>12</sub>} clusters were grafted onto Ag-MOF to yield two 3D POMOFs that exhibit outstanding electrochemical supercapacitor and sensing properties.
